How much does it cost to rent a home in Franconia?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Franconia 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,744 | $1,799 | $4,000 |
Franconia 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,522 | $2,500 | $4,500 |
Franconia 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,409 | $3,200 | $5,800 |
Franconia 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,500 | $3,400 | $5,600 |
Franconia 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,975 | $800 | $7,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Franconia
What type of rentals are currently available in Franconia?
There are currently 105 Apartments for Rent in Franconia, VA with pricing that ranges from $1,300 to $6,269. There are also 67 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Franconia ranging from $795 to $7,150.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Franconia?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Franconia ranges from $795 to $7,150 with an average monthly rent of $3,211.
